Output e1bab09ddd103b80dd58fc3ff1b23efb9df63577b62c71e26aef8955a26b9b85:6

value
1076085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4ed2e1d056a9db5a4f01e475c473d09ce1421db OP_EQUAL
address
3Q24vv1Rvpc2S8AyYoXiVXFevmqurrydYW
transaction
e1bab09ddd103b80dd58fc3ff1b23efb9df63577b62c71e26aef8955a26b9b85
spent
true